Abstract

PURPOSE: To simply prevent heat dissipation during the fire extinguishment at a circulation type bath furnace, by shutting off a circulation pipe throughout the fire extinguishment.
CONSTITUTION: A check valve comprising a valve element 7, a spring 8 and a spring fixation plate 9 is installed near the blowoff baffle plate 5 of a bathtub 1. In heating, water in the bathtub 1 flows through a low temperature side pipe 2 and is heated by a bath furnace 3 and then flows through a high temperature side pipe 4 and returns to the bathtube 1 while thrusting the spring 8 inwards to open the check valve. During fire extinguishment, the check valve is closed by the spring 8 and the circulation pipes 2, 4 are shut off so that a circulation passage is disconnected. Therefore, hot water convection does not occur during the fire extinguishment, accordingly, the water once heated and stored in the bathtub 1 is not heat-exchanged at the furnace 3 nor the heat of water dissipates during convection.
